Dr. Meryem Youssoufi is a distinguished Professor of Sociology and Anthropology at University Ibn Zohr. Her academic journey is defined by a deep commitment to understanding the complexities of human society, particularly in the context of migration, citizenship, and social dynamics.

She believes in the power of research not just as an academic exercise, but as a tool for real-world transformation. Her work bridges the gap between theoretical frameworks and practical applications, making significant contributions to both the academic community and civil society.

Project CITER

Europe and the Borders of Citizenship

Dr. Youssoufi serves as the principal coordinator for this major international research initiative. Bridging University Ibn Zohr and the Catholic University of the West (UCO) in France, the project critically examines the evolving definitions of citizenship, identity building, and minority rights in a globalized world.

Chess Leadership

President of the Souss-Massa Regional Chess League

Making history as the first woman in Morocco to hold this prestigious position, Dr. Youssoufi brings a visionary approach to sports leadership. She combines strategic thinking with a passion for community development.

🏆 Historic Victory

Under her guidance, the 'Najah Souss' club secured the 2024-2025 Throne Cup, marking a significant milestone in regional sports excellence.
